CHANCELLOR OF FLORENCE
The 'Chancellor of Florence' held the most important position in the bureaucracy of the Florentine Republic but did not hold any political power.
★ Coluccio Salutati (appointed 1375)
★ Leonardo Bruni (appointed 1410)
★ Carlo Marsuppini
★ Poggio Bracciolini (1453-1459)
★ Benedetto Accolti (appointed 1459)
★ Bartolomeo Scala (1465-1497)
★ Niccolò Machiavelli
